Output 660c516aee38f25a1db93d05cb5f6c9bb05e0283230cf02b591ad28b7e2c83f5:1

value
39981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ed784ee91b7aff315fd4d8079615bcfa9cfb7839 OP_EQUAL
address
3PLeCAsGfeRri2MxbAS8vGvwgAsiq5Z211
transaction
660c516aee38f25a1db93d05cb5f6c9bb05e0283230cf02b591ad28b7e2c83f5
confirmations
420664
spent
true